In this video you will learn how to program an ESP Feather to make the VL53L1X Time-of-Flight Sensor write on the OLED Display (both 4-pin display and 8-pin display)

Tools:
Breadboard x2
OLED Display (4-pin or 8-pin)
ESP Feather M0 LE
VL53L1X Time-of-Flight Sensor
Male DuPont (For connections)

Libraries needed:
Adafruit_SSD1306
Adafruit_VL53L1X
Adafruit_GFX

Boards Manager Name:
Adafruit SAMD Boards (By Adafruit)
